Station History & Timeline
21 Events
1916 10月31日

It opened as a stop on the Keio Electric Tramway.

1925 3月24日

The Gyokunan Electric Railway opened.

1926 12月1日

Gyokunan Electric Railway was absorbed into Keio Electric Railway.

1928 5月22日

The current Keio Line, which was previously divided into the Keio Line and the Tamamin Line at this station, was connected, and direct service between Shinjuku Station and Higashi-Hachioji Station began.

1944 5月31日

The station became part of Tokyu Corporation (Dai-Tokyu) due to the wartime merger under the Land Transport Business Adjustment Act.

1948 6月1日

The station was separated from Tokyu and became a station of Keio Teito Electric Railway.

1974

The down platform was extended, and the down passing track was abolished due to the extension work.

1981 10月16日

Work began on the elevated construction project as part of the station surrounding continuous grade separation project.

1983

The platform was extended to accommodate 10-car train sets.

1989 10月14日

In 1989, the down line was elevated.

1991 4月27日

The up line was elevated.

1993 3月1日

The new station building began operation and the continuous grade-separation project was completed.

1996 3月20日

The station building "Keio Fuchu Shopping Center" (now Puratto Keio Fuchu) opened.

1998 10月14日

It was selected for the Kanto 100 Best Stations, with the selection reason being "a station that evokes the image of an urban and modern museum".

2001 3月27日

A semi-express service was newly established with the timetable revision, and it became a stop.

2013 4月24日

The use of "bun bun bun" and "Fuchu Ondo" as approaching melodies began.

2015 4月1日

The subsidiary station name "Meisei Junior and Senior High School Meisei Elementary School Meisei Kindergarten Nearest Station" was established.

2018 2月22日

With the timetable revision, the downbound Keio Liner was newly established and the station became a stop, with downbound travel from the station possible without a reserved seat ticket.

2019 2月22日

With the timetable revision, the station became a stop for the new upbound Keio Liner, for which a reserved seat ticket is required, although it is not needed for downbound trains.

2020 2月12日

The regular ticket sales counter has closed.

2022 3月12日

The semi-express service was abolished as it was integrated into the express service due to a timetable revision.
